Problem Statement of Perfect Number
A perfect number is a positive integer that is equal to the sum of its positive divisors, excluding the number itself. A divisor of an integer x is an integer that can divide x evenly.
Given an integer n, return true if n is a perfect number, otherwise return false.
Example 1:
Input: num = 28
Output: true
Explanation: 28 = 1 + 2 + 4 + 7 + 14
1, 2, 4, 7, and 14 are all divisors of 28.
Example 2:
Input: num = 7
Output: false
Constraints:
1 <= num <= 108
Complexity Analysis
- Time Complexity: O(\sqrt{n}) \to O(1)
- Space Complexity: O(1)
507. Perfect Number LeetCode Solution in C++
class Solution {
public:
bool checkPerfectNumber(int num) {
if (num == 1)
return false;
int sum = 1;
for (int i = 2; i <= sqrt(num); ++i)
if (num % i == 0)
sum += i + num / i;
return sum == num;
}
};

507. Perfect Number LeetCode Solution in Java
class Solution {
public boolean checkPerfectNumber(int num) {
if (num == 1)
return false;
int sum = 1;
for (int i = 2; i <= Math.sqrt(num); ++i)
if (num % i == 0)
sum += i + num / i;
return sum == num;
}
}

507. Perfect Number LeetCode Solution in Python
class Solution:
def checkPerfectNumber(self, num: int) -> bool:
return num in {6, 28, 496, 8128, 33550336}
